Borough planners have recently made a significant decision regarding a vital segment of the West Cheltenham development, which includes plans for 1,100 new homes alongside essential community facilities such as a new school and a GP surgery. This development, located on the edge of Cheltenham, aims to meet growing housing demands while enhancing local infrastructure and healthcare access.
The approved proposal is seen as a critical step forward in accommodating Cheltenham’s expanding population. The inclusion of a school and a GP surgery ensures that the development will support the wellbeing and educational needs of future residents. Borough planners emphasized the importance of integrating these facilities within the housing project to create a sustainable and vibrant community.
This decision marks a turning point for the West Cheltenham area, aligning with broader efforts to deliver much-needed housing and services. The project is expected to stimulate local growth and contribute positively to the region’s long-term development strategy.
